The opera is designed to connect the sea and dry land. A reminder of sea waves but mountain slopes as well. It is the boundary between the two elements. The building functions as a performing arts center. It is a shell that will shelter all the facilities that constitute an opera. The services are placed beneath a huge “umbrella”, organized in order to function. Both the auditoria are designed to house high-class events and the associated auxiliary spaces are capable to host smaller art events. The single shell idea is ecologically friendly as it allows it to function as a sustainable entity.
